Dundalk Home Office Build-Out: Permit, Scope and Quote Checklist

A Dundalk home office estimate should first separate a non-permanent setup from a real residential alteration. A desk, paint and loose furniture job is not the same scope as built-in cabinetry, new lighting, added outlets, insulation, sound control, HVAC work, a basement or garage conversion, or a room addition. Use the local midpoint on this page only after the bid states what is permanent, what is movable and who handles Baltimore County permit or trade-permit checks.

Quote line 1

Scope tier: spare-room setup, built-in desk and shelving, sound-controlled office, basement or garage office conversion, or new conditioned addition.

Quote line 2

Permanent work: electrical circuits, outlet count, task lighting, low-voltage/data wiring, HVAC or mini-split, insulation, sound control, drywall, flooring, doors, windows, trim, paint and built-in cabinetry.

Quote line 3

Baltimore County check: identify whether the job includes an addition, alteration, structural modification, new conditioned space, electrical work, HVAC work, or exterior/window changes before assuming no permit is needed.

Quote line 4

Closeout: Maryland contractor license check, permit responsibility, inspection scheduling, material allowances, cleanup, warranty, final photos and written change-order pricing for hidden wiring, moisture, framing or HVAC issues.

Local permit checks

  • 1.Dundalk projects are generally handled through Baltimore County permitting. Baltimore County says permits are required for additions, alterations or structural modifications to existing dwellings, including historic-district properties.
  • 2.A simple home office furniture, paint and decor refresh may not need a building permit, but wall changes, structural work, exterior openings, added circuits, HVAC modifications, plumbing or a conversion to conditioned living area should be checked before work starts.
  • 3.Baltimore County publishes a building permit fee schedule for new construction, alterations, additions and other construction-related permit work; confirm the current valuation and fee basis before filing.
  • 4.Maryland Home Improvement Commission says it licenses and regulates home improvement contractors and salespersons; for paid residential alteration, remodeling, repair or replacement work, verify the MHIC license before signing.

Home Office Build-Out Scope Audit for Dundalk, MD

Reviewed June 11, 2026

Home office quotes are only comparable when the contractor separates furniture and finish work from permanent residential alteration. Define whether the job is a spare-room setup, built-in cabinetry package, soundproofed office, garage or basement conversion, or new conditioned addition before comparing prices. Use the $12,587 midpoint as a planning number, then require the written scope below before comparing Dundalk contractor bids.

Scope checks

  • - Room type: existing spare room, basement room, garage bay, attic nook, addition, or detached workspace, with square footage and final use stated.
  • - Permanent work: framing changes, doors, windows, insulation, sound control, flooring, drywall repair, built-in desk/shelving, lighting, outlets, data wiring, HVAC or mini-split, and paint.
  • - Code and comfort checks: electrical load, AFCI/GFCI needs, ventilation, heating/cooling path, smoke/CO alarm impact, egress if the room may later be marketed as a bedroom, and lead-safe work for older homes.
  • - Closeout: permit responsibility when work goes beyond furniture or paint, inspection scheduling, final photos, warranty, cleanup, and written change-order pricing for hidden wiring, moisture, framing or HVAC issues.

Ask before deposit

  • - Is this priced as a non-permanent office setup, a built-in/cabinetry job, a finished room conversion, or a structural addition?
  • - Which electrical, low-voltage, HVAC, insulation, soundproofing, window, door and built-in items are included by model or allowance?
  • - Who confirms building, electrical, mechanical or historic-district permit triggers before the deposit is paid?

Common misses

  • - Comparing a desk-and-paint quote with a quote that includes circuits, lighting, built-ins, insulation, HVAC and inspection closeout.
  • - No written plan for heat, cooling, ventilation, data wiring, sound control or outlet placement.
  • - Assuming a finished office can later be counted as a legal bedroom without egress, smoke/CO and local approval checks.

Does a Dundalk home office build-out need a Baltimore County permit?
It depends on scope. A furniture and paint refresh may not need a building permit, but Baltimore County says permits are required for additions, alterations or structural modifications to existing dwellings. Electrical circuits, HVAC changes, exterior openings, wall changes, structural work, historic-district work or a conversion to conditioned living space should be verified with Baltimore County before work starts.
What should a Dundalk home office contractor quote include?
A Dundalk home office quote should list the room type, square footage, built-ins, desk and storage allowances, lighting, outlet and data wiring plan, HVAC or ventilation scope, insulation and sound-control assumptions, drywall and flooring, permit responsibility, MHIC license information, inspection closeout, cleanup, warranty and change-order pricing.
